LCD显示模块空屏无显示产生的原因及解决办法

目前很多显示设备使用的都是lcd显示屏,而在使用过程可能会偶尔遇到空屏无显示的情况。对于此类现象你有详细了解过其产生的原因以及如何去解决吗?下面就让我们来简单介绍一下吧!
基本背景
1. 对应产品类
单片机接口的 tft lcd / 单色 lcd模块,特指单芯片单片机接口 lcd显示产品。
2. 什么是空屏无显示
空屏无显示是指在(怀疑)外来干扰下, 让lcd显示变为空屏无显示;空屏无显示时, 系统还在正常工作;关机重启或系统复位可恢复正常。
3. 为什么会出现空屏?
空屏无显示一般是关显示的状态, 也是lcd显示模块的复位/启动默认状态。当lcd显示模块接收到重启命令或复位信号,它便会回到默认状态, 造成空屏无显示的情况。
lcd空屏的可能原因与解决方案
1. lcd显示模块复位信号悬空
在设计上, 不应该把模块的输入口悬空, 复位信号也是输入口。相关接口最好与单片机相连, 直接由单片机控制。
2. 接口接触不良
需要注意信号连接的可靠性。
3. 主机误发出复位信号, 复位命令或关显示的命令
需要跟踪程序流程, 找出关键点。
4. 相关白屏幕通常会在干扰性测试中发现 (如: 静电(esd)测试) 
一般产品设计, 显示模块都设置于产品前方;外来esd会让显示模块暴露于相关电场之中;干扰是不一定会直接影响信号或复位。但是相关干扰是很容易影响0v或电源,造成lcd 显示模块误判信号电压;缩短主机与显示模块的接线距离长度是有一定的效果,在复位信号连接上增加电阻/电容也可改善相关情况。 (参考值: r=100r, c=0.01uf)
5. 其他方案
面对现场可能出现的未知干扰, 建议周期性刷新显示内容与相关屏幕初始化设定, 以改善/恢复因为干扰而造成的显示异常情况;
当界面菜单转跳回 “主页” 时, 一般为全屏幕刷新,可考虑在此过程中重刷相关屏幕初始化设定,已保证显示模块设定正确;
考虑复位默认为”关显示”,单片机也可定时读回显示状态, 以了解lcd 显示模块是否在正常显示的状态;如发现异常, 主机可以发出硬复位, 重新初始化lcd显示模块与重刷显示内容, 以保证显示正常。
结语
lcd 显示模块是从器件, 听命于输入的命令与信号;lcd 显示模块没有能力判定相关输入的正确性;良好的供电与合理的走线布局是良好显示的基本;软件的监控补偿更可进一步提高系统的保证。更多关于lcd显示模块问题,欢迎咨询我们!


Eden Immersive推出B端VR一体机Snacker 旨在快速展示VR内容
harmony是什么意思 为何取名为鸿蒙
苹果M1芯片Mac mini拆解:内存不可升级
怎样制作带电压表的降压模块
采用CPLD器件和LM1881芯片的激光发射信号调制系统的设计
LCD显示模块空屏无显示产生的原因及解决办法
人工智能时代带来的影响将如何应对?
A3与BLDC电机使用过程记录
USB 3.0接口技术在机器视觉中的应用研究
iphone13发布时间
基于VC6.0平台实现组播技术的方法及在飞行仿真系统中的应用研究
阻容降压中的限流电阻发热的原因
捷杰传感“黑科技”:车载远程在线诊断系统为重卡智能化升级与改造提供大数据支持
Intel CPU架构升级将提升至5年,下一代架构代号NGC
开关稳压器LT8616的性能特点、功能及应用分析
2015年无线领域十大热门新技术
微型软体机器人在体内/体外生物医学研究中具备广泛应用
印制电路板的诞生故事是什么
科学家设计功能性磁共振成像治疗恐惧症
创基Type-C hub集线器充电续航不断电